The first weekend of March is the brujo (witch) festival in Los Tuxtlas. The epicenter for all of Mexico and much of Central America is Catemaco. They gather for a couple of days and do ritual cleansings of themselves. Then, out they go to sell their power to believers. They set up booths, like these in Santiago and do their thing.


The sign says that this witch, Francisca Vergara Mendosa, is prepared to do card readings, palm readings, has potions to sell, removes bad spells, and also sells amulets and other "magical" junk jewlery. Groovy.
